Make More, Spend Less!
Is your web site losing money? Believe it or not, it's not hard to make a profit in the first few months of web site/online business launch. You simply must budget. Well, I guess it's not that easy, deciding what you don't need, and what you do.
First of all, start off by eliminating the services that you absolutely don't need. Do you really need to be paying for all that banner advertising? Is it really worth what you're paying? You probably shouldn't be paying more than a few cents a click. You can fair much better advertising in a Pay-Per-Click Search Engine.
What about your web hosting plan, do you really need all that space? You might consider reducing your plan, or finding a new web host with enough space to grow but reasonable priced. Believe me, they're out there.
So we've covered some of the cost-cutting techniques, now what about the making more part of it?
Are you currently a part of an advertising network such as DoubleClick? If you are chances are you're not making as much as you could if you went out and recruited your own advertisers. This can be difficult, but try to find advertiser that are advertising on site related to yours, email them and ask if they would be interested in advertising with you.
You may also want to join a program such as Commission Junction if you haven't already. They offer 1000's of affiliate programs to join, chances are there are a few programs in there that would fair well on your web site. Integrate your links discretely and try joining their service yourself, it it's any good recommend it to your visitors in newsletters, in articles, etc.
Fill your unsold banner space with affiliate banner links, but always give advertisers first priority. If you can pick up 2-3 great advertisers who stay with you month after month, you should be in good shape.
These are just a few ways to maximize profit, and decrease spending. To recap: cut what you don't absolutely don't need, and take advantage of advertising and affiliate programs.
